Audit item 14: Homegrown job queue replacement

Check that all Brindlework services have migrated off the old "Stackpigeon" queue and onto the managed Conveyly queue. Support should confirm no retry loops or stuck jobs remain in legacy dashboards, and that runbooks reference the new queue paths. If a customer reports delayed jobs, verify which queue handled them before escalating. Any lingering Stackpigeon traffic should be flagged to the migration owner, named below.

named custodian: Belius Casath Ulaix Sorius

## Further Reading

If you're on call for Meterling, per-tenant rate quotas are the thing that'll page you most. Quotas are enforced at the Foxhollow gateway, and most incidents are just a tenant outgrowing their tier. Before bumping anything, skim the quota policy and escalation steps — they're written up internally here.

operations page: https://kibana.sivrelcloud.corp/browse/spaces/spaces/issue/16dd39fa3e3f990c

## Tile Prefetcher: Limits & Quotas

The Lornvale prefetcher speculatively pulls map tiles around the viewport. If it runs hot, origin fetch costs spike and the CDN cache churns. On-call: do not raise the concurrency cap without checking origin egress first. Throttles are enforced per region; exceeding them trips the circuit breaker and drops to on-demand fetching only. Current enforced values are listed below.

tuning constants:
QUOTAS = {
    "druwyn": 5,
    "holix": 5,
    "zorath": 5,
    "holwyn": 10,
}